MorphoHDL introduces a minimalistic hardware description language designed for growing circuits through developmental principles. Hosted at paradigms-of-intelligence.github.io, the project explores bio-inspired approaches to circuit design where structures emerge through growth processes rather than explicit specification. The language emphasizes simplicity and emergent complexity, enabling designers to define developmental rules that automatically generate functional circuit topologies.
